Failed to start ssh@.service: Unit name ssh@.service is missing the instance name.
时间: 2024-05-04 13:20:09 浏览: 272
这个错误通常是由于没有指定正确的 SSH 实例名称引起的。SSH 服务是以 ssh@.service 的形式运行的,其中“@”符号后面是 SSH 实例的名称。例如,如果要启动一个名为“example”的 SSH 实例,则应使用以下命令:
```
sudo systemctl start ssh@example.service
```
请确保您在使用 SSH 服务时使用正确的实例名称。
相关问题
Failed to start openvpn-server@.service: Unit name openvpn-server@.service is missing the instance name.
这个错误通常是由于在启动 `openvpn-server@.service` 服务时没有指定实例名称导致的。您需要指定要启动的实例名称。例如,如果您要启动 `openvpn-server@server1.service` 实例,则可以使用以下命令启动它:
```
systemctl start openvpn-server@server1.service
```
请注意,您需要将 `server1` 替换为您实际要启动的实例名称。
Failed to start ssh.service: Unit ssh.service is masked.
这个错误说明 SSH 服务已经被系统屏蔽了,可能是因为系统安全策略的原因。你可以尝试使用以下命令来解除屏蔽:
```
sudo systemctl unmask ssh.service
```
然后再尝试启动 SSH 服务:
```
sudo systemctl start ssh.service
```
如果仍然无法启动,你可以查看 `journalctl -xe` 命令的输出,以获取更多错误信息。
阅读全文